On Saturday, October 19, 2019 the Montclair Community Pre-K celebrated the Grand Opening of their “Discovery Playground and Gardens” during their annual Harvest Festival. Mayor Robert Jackson along with Third Ward Councilman Sean Spiller joined in on the ribbon cutting ceremony.

“For so long, I have been proud of the Montclair Community Pre-K. While there is always an emphasis on how important academic work in the classroom is, it is just as important to care for the social and emotional well-being of our children. That’s why making sure that kids are out here, having fun and also learning ow to interact with each other to solve issues, is so vital,” said Councilman Spiller.

The Discovery Playground features interactive drum and music spaces where children can create and feel their musical beats on drums. A shared nest-swing space where pairs can learn to swing and share cooperatively is also part of the new space. The Garden allows children to learn about horticulture growth and cultivation.

The MCPK prides itself on creating a welcoming, inclusive play-based learning environment for 3 – 5 year olds. The playground will be open to the Montclair community during off school hours and weekends.
